Plugin authors: the PickFlow optimizer now scores bins by travel cost, not aisle order. If your plugin overrides `score_bin()`, call `super()` first or you'll lose the congestion penalty entirely — we saw this break the Harlowe Depot integration last sprint. Don't hardcode weights; read them from the tuning block so ops can retune without a redeploy. Also, `max_detour_m` is enforced post-hoc now, so clamping it yourself is redundant. The defaults the core engine ships with are listed below.

tuning constants:
RATE_LIMITS = {
    "wenwyn": 1,
    "zorix": 10,
    "oliix": 2,
    "holael": 10,
}

**Alert: flaky-integration-tests (Paylark payments service)**

This fires when the Paylark integration suite flakes above 8% over a rolling hour. Usually it's the mock acquirer timing out, not a real regression — but please don't just mute it. Flaky runs have masked genuine auth-check failures twice before, which is why security now gets paged too. Check recent merges touching the settlement and refund paths first, then retry the suite once. Triage steps and known flaky-test history are documented here:

wiki page, fahaf-yagag: https://confluence.qorvellabs.internal/pages/display/pages/display

Quick notes on Splitbranch, our A/B assignment service, before the sync. Assignment drift usually means the bucketing seed got rotated without flushing the Larkspur cache — check that first, it's the culprit nine times out of ten. If assignments look stale, you can force a reshuffle from the admin endpoint, but warn analytics first or their cohorts get weird. The admin endpoint needs auth against the internal Splitbranch gateway, so grab the key below.

API key for tagef-fafop: vxb2-ta